On Fri, 16 Sep 2011 19:18:25 +0200, Sebastian Andrzej Siewior <bigeasy@linutronix.de> wrote:
> * Greg KH | 2011-09-09 11:43:54 [-0700]: > >> So we can expect more patches like this adding all of the possible >> permutations of the different gadget devices? >> >> If so, ick, I thought that the work that was done was to prevent this >> from happening, oh well :( > > Would it be possible to come up with a gadget-hub driver which can have > multiple gadget attached? This should get rid of this kind of gadget > drivers, right?
Yes, I keep thinking about such a thing for years now...
Instead of a “gadget HUB” which would have to do a lot of translation of headers and requests, I was thinking more of making USB composite functions even more structured (ie. adding callback for per-gadget setup, per-configuration set-up, etc.) and then creating a composite layer which would be feed with a trivial structure describing which functions are to be included in which configurations.
Like I've said before, that's almost what Android does, expect it does not support many configurations.
